The timeline for a custom home or major renovation depends on design complexity, permitting, site considerations, and material selections.
Most thoughtfully crafted custom homes take 12–24+ months from early planning through completion.
For large-scale renovations, especially those involving structural changes, full interior reconfiguration, or taking a home down to the studs, the process typically spans 8–18 months, depending on scope, permitting, and existing site conditions.
Beginning with a robust pre-construction phase helps clarify the schedule, align expectations, and create a smoother path from vision to finished home.
